Does anyone know if PyThreadState_SetAsyncExc stops a thread while its inside a native extension ? I'm trying to stop a testing script that boils down to this:
while True: print "aaa" native_extension_call() print "bbb" Using PyThreadState_SetAsyncExc the module doesn't stop but if I add more print statements to increase the chance that PyThreadState_SetAsyncExc is called when the module is executing Python code, the module stops. _______________________________________________ Python-Dev mailing list Python-Dev@python.org http://mail.python.org/mailman/listinfo/python-dev Unsubscribe: http://mail.python.org/mailman/options/python-dev/archive%40mail-archive.com